The Tooling and Test Fixture Section is a team of Mechanical Engineers who support the Advanced Product Center and their customers. The Mechanical Engineer I will be responsible for all aspects of the Special Tooling Mechanical design. This includes design conception, to CAD modeling and drawing completion of low to moderate complexity Special Tools and Special Test Fixtures under the general supervision of a team lead. This position is an onsite role in McKinney, TX.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Mechanical Engineering
  • This position requires 12 months or less of relevant professional work experience (excluding internships).
  • Experience with Microsoft suite
  • Experience with 3D modelling such as Creo (or equivalent) and ACAD.
  • Experience with interpretting engineering drawings, including a basic knowledge and understanding of GD&T

Responsibilities

  • Design, drawing creation using Creo Parametric
  • Obtaining quotes for make versus buy decisions for fabrication and assembly
  • Following proper documentation and tracking guidelines for customer owned property
  • Support of Special Tooling once the product build has started.
  • Support assembly of your designs
  • Support of automated test set design, build, and assembly
  • Implement mechanical engineering best practices in planning, development, and execution of scope, schedule, and budget.
  • Effectively communicate technical information to project leads and in design review settings
